The Cousins
The Cousins is a small Italian restaurant in Cape Town that focuses on traditional cooking from Emilia-Romagna. The kitchen staff make fresh pasta daily and use natural ingredients following family recipes.
The restaurant was opened when the three cousins moved to Cape Town because they missed authentic Italian cooking. Since then it has served as a trusted place for the community.
The restaurant was founded by three cousins from Emilia-Romagna in Italy. They share family recipes and stories about their grandmother Nonna Tina, whose cooking tradition shapes what they serve today.
The location is close to Cape Town's center and is best visited with a reservation, especially on weekends. Groups can book space for up to 15 people, and you can bring your own wine bottle though a small fee applies.
